Gardaí appeal for information on missing Louth teen

Jaylen Brady, 15, has been missing since Sunday 1st of February

Gardaí are seeking the public's assistance in tracing the whereabouts of 15 year-old Jayden Brady, who was reported missing from Dunleer, Co Louth since Sunday, 1st February 2026.

Jayden is described as being approximately 5 foot 8 inches in height with a slim build, blonde hair and blue eyes.
 
When last seen, he was wearing a dark grey tracksuit, grey Zanetti jacket and black runners. Jayden may be in the Dublin area.

Gardaí are concerned for Jayden’s well-being.
 
Anyone with any information on Jayden's whereabouts is asked to contact Drogheda Garda Station on 041 987 4200, the Garda Confidential Line on 1800 666 111, or any Garda Station.
